Let’s look at how cubic zirconia came to exist. Cubic zirconia, is a mineral that naturally occurs like traditional diamonds and was first discovered in 1937. Cubic zirconia is rare and hard to acquire but a chemical process discovered in the 1960’s allowed scientists to reproduce cubic zirconia and produce a crystalline form of zirconium dioxide. In appearance, they look just like diamonds to the naked eye because even though they have a bit less sparkle they cast more rays of color. Created in a lab, the CZ are typically flawless and about 70% heavier than diamonds but more brittle and soft. Diamonds naturally have flaws and impurities. Both come in a variety of colors. In the CZ, this is achieved by adding oxides such as nickel, iron, titanium, etc. during the CZ synthesis process. CZ has a hardness rating of eight on the Moh’s scale compared to man-made diamonds with a hardness rating of 10 on the Moh’s Scale. CZ can replicate the look of the finest-cut natural diamonds.
